Flower Structure
Description of Flower Characteristics πΌ
The Yellow Coneflower is a striking sight in any garden. Its bright yellow petals are elongated and droop slightly, creating a star-like appearance that draws the eye.
At the center, a prominent, spiky brownish cone stands out, rich in nectar. This central feature is essential for attracting pollinators, while the green sepals, often unnoticed, provide crucial support to the vibrant petals.
Role in Pollination π
The arrangement of stamens and pistils within the cone allows for self-pollination. This means that the flower can fertilize itself, ensuring reproduction even in the absence of pollinators.
However, the structure also facilitates cross-pollination. By attracting a variety of pollinator species, the Yellow Coneflower enhances genetic diversity, which is vital for the health of ecosystems.
Pollination Process
πΌ Mechanisms of Pollination
Self-Pollination
Yellow coneflowers have a unique structure that allows for self-pollination. Pollen from the stamens can easily transfer to the pistil within the same flower, ensuring reproduction even in the absence of pollinators.
Cross-Pollination
While self-pollination is effective, cross-pollination enhances genetic diversity. Primary pollinators like bees, butterflies, moths, and hummingbirds are attracted to the bright yellow petals and rich nectar, facilitating this process as they move from flower to flower.
π Natural Pollination
Pollen Transfer Mechanisms
Pollen dispersal occurs naturally through wind and the activity of visiting pollinators. As these creatures interact with the flower, they inadvertently carry pollen to other blooms, promoting cross-pollination.
Importance for Reproduction
Successful pollination is crucial for seed formation. This process not only ensures the continuation of the species but also enhances genetic diversity, making the population more resilient to environmental changes.

Hand Pollination
Step-by-Step Instructions
Identify Male and Female Flower Parts:
Start by locating the stamens, which are the male parts, and the pistil, the female part, within the flower. This is crucial for effective hand pollination.Collecting Pollen:
Use a small brush or cotton swab to gently collect pollen from the stamens. This method ensures you gather enough pollen without damaging the flower.Transferring Pollen:
Carefully apply the collected pollen to the stigma of the pistil. This step is vital for initiating the fertilization process.Timing:
Perform this process during peak blooming periods for optimal success. Timing can significantly influence the likelihood of successful fertilization.
π± Ensuring Successful Fertilization
Monitor for signs of fertilization, such as swelling of the ovary. This indicates that the pollen has successfully fertilized the ovules, leading to seed development.

Supporting Pollinators
πΌ Creating a Pollinator-Friendly Environment
To attract a variety of pollinator species, plant a diverse range of flowering plants. This diversity not only provides food sources but also creates a vibrant ecosystem that supports various insects and birds.
Additionally, ensure there are adequate habitats for pollinators. Providing shelter and nesting sites, such as brush piles or bee hotels, can significantly enhance their chances of thriving in your garden.
π± Suggested Companion Plants
Native wildflowers are excellent companions for Yellow Coneflower. Plants like Black-eyed Susans and Purple Coneflowers not only thrive alongside but also attract beneficial pollinators.
Herbs can also play a vital role in drawing in pollinators. Consider planting mint and basil, which are not only useful in the kitchen but also serve as a magnet for bees and butterflies.

Pollination Challenges
Common Obstacles π
Pollination success can be significantly affected by environmental factors. Temperature fluctuations, high humidity, and adverse weather conditions can deter pollinators, making it harder for flowers like the Yellow Coneflower to thrive.
Additionally, the decline in pollinator populations poses a serious challenge. Factors such as habitat loss and pesticide use have led to fewer bees, butterflies, and other essential pollinators, directly impacting the pollination process.
Solutions for Overcoming Challenges πΌ
To enhance pollination success, consider planting in clusters. This strategy increases visibility and accessibility for pollinators, making it easier for them to find and visit your flowers.
Timing adjustments can also be beneficial. By planting at different times, you can align your blooms with peak pollinator activity, ensuring that your Yellow Coneflowers attract the necessary visitors for successful pollination.
